In Fiction
"Kidnapped" by Robert Louis Stevenson.
According to Don Rosa, Castle McDuck, the ancestral home of Scrooge McDuck's family, the Clan McDuck is located in Dismal Downs somewhere on Rannoch Moor.
In DC Comics' Swamp Thing Rannoch Moor was the site of MacCobb castle, home of the werewolf Ian MacCobb.
In the 1996 film Trainspotting, Tommy and the gang get off an Intercity train to "get some fresh air" on a hike at Corrour railway station, which is located on Rannoch Moor.
In The System of the World, by Neal Stephenson, Rufus MacIan says "On the Muir of Rannoch, they grow braw, or they grow na at all".
